Giant Squid

GiantSquidPhoto01A common villain in ocean adventure stories, the giant squid began its relationship with man as a sea monster. Today, its existence is undoubted and it has a scientific name, Architeuthis, but little is known about how it lives. There are several species of giant squid that exceed 7 feet in length. There are other squids that are also huge, such as the Colossal squid.

Most squid are small, have a torpedo-shaped body, eight arms plus two longer tentacles. The arms and tentacles are lined with disc-shaped suckers. Squid are very numerous in the ocean and are eaten by whales.  There are several accounts of sperm whales battling giant squid. While we know that whales eat squid, the squid probably don’t eat anything larger than themselves – that is, squid do not eat whales.

The ultimate length of a giant squid is difficult to determine since the two tentacles extend much longer than the body or other arms. Some recovered specimens washed on shore or found in fishing nets are not complete enough to judge total size. The length of the main body (mantle) can exceed 6 feet with tentacles over 20 feet. There are specimens, body parts and eyewitness accounts that tell of giants far larger than that. Several expeditions to find and capture live giant squid on film have met with failure but a rare few have been successful, as shown in the picture on the left.

With their elusive lifestyle they remain mysterious monsters of the deep.
